Re: Newsletter
Since nobody answered me this so far, a couple of findings
1) the Newsletter EXT creates a dedicated option in the ACP (ADM) > System > General Tasks > Email Newsletter
2) in order for this EXT to send out HTML, it needs both the
 HTML email EXT and the 
 Editor extension.
3) if you activated the
 HTML email EXT, every message sent through this extension, then it's not sent as Plain Text, but HTML (therefore it ignores your layout)
4) there is no option like other Newsletter EXTs where you can set "Newsletter: When this is activated you will receive the newsletter frequently".
5) this EXT uses the "Administrators can email me information" function in UCP > Board Preferences > Edit global settings. If you got this turned off, nobody will get your newsletter
BONUS:
Add-on works in phpBB 3.3.4 (didn't test 3.3.5 yet - as it was just released)
As good as this add-on is, it needs one essential function, or rather two:
A) it needs an option in the UCP to let users turn the newsletter on/off
Due to laws in Europe, this is a highly risky topic (spam and unwanted advertising). This needs to be available as option, as I do not see/know of a method to manually turn on/off newsletters for certain users. A workaround might be a custom group, but creating one for 1000+ users currently is not an option for me.
B) on initial installation / activation, "force enable" newsletter for everyone
Also see A. On first install, everyone should be signed up to the newsletter. If not, there should be a global override option that you can access if needed (for example: fix newsletters once every year). This way, an already "live" forum can be updated with a new Newsletter engine (as mentioned in my previous post, I am using phpbbde/newsletter by Oliver Schramm -- but the requests for HTML options don't seem to happen) anytime soon, also "still alpha", even though it works perfectly).
I would love to use this add-on as this would finally fix a long-term issue on my end (readability of info mails). But without an option in the UCP (User Control Panel), I currently can't use this.
